首页 >

如何优化MySQL数据库性能,让你的网站飞一般的快 |c mysql linux

mysql 求差集,php mysql insert 数组,mysql 链接数量限制,mysql 查看表锁 信息,mysql死锁代码,c mysql linux如何优化MySQL数据库性能,让你的网站飞一般的快 |c mysql linux

1.合理设计数据库结构

合理的数据库结构可以提高查询效率,减少不必要的查询,从而提高数据库性能。大家需要遵循数据库设计的三范式,把数据分解成尽可能小的数据单元,避免冗余数据的出现。

2.选择合适的数据类型

选择合适的数据类型可以减少存储空间的浪费,提高查询效率。例如,使用INT数据类型可以节约存储空间,同时也可以提高查询效率。

3.建立索引

索引可以加速数据的查询,提高数据库性能。但是过多的索引会降低插入、更新、删除等操作的效率,因此需要根据实际情况选择合适的索引。

4.优化查询语句

优化查询语句可以减少不必要的查询,提高查询效率。大家需要避免使用SELECT *,避免使用子查询,避免使用OR等效率低下的语句。

5.优化数据库参数

优化数据库参数可以提高数据库性能。大家需要根据实际情况设置合适的缓存大小、连接数、线程数等参数。

6.使用缓存技术

cached、Redis等缓存技术来缓存数据。

7.分库分表

分库分表可以提高数据库的承载能力,减少单个数据库的压力。大家可以根据业务需求来进行分库分表。

通过以上优化,可以提高MySQL数据库的性能,让网站飞一般的快。


如何优化MySQL数据库性能,让你的网站飞一般的快 |c mysql linux
  • 如何优化MySQL数据库性能,让你的网站运行更加流畅? |mysql 伪劣
  • 如何优化MySQL数据库性能,让你的网站运行更加流畅? |mysql 伪劣 | 如何优化MySQL数据库性能,让你的网站运行更加流畅? |mysql 伪劣 ...

    如何优化MySQL数据库性能,让你的网站飞一般的快 |c mysql linux
  • 如何优化mysql数据库性能,让你的网站速度更快 |mysql initfile
  • 如何优化mysql数据库性能,让你的网站速度更快 |mysql initfile | 如何优化mysql数据库性能,让你的网站速度更快 |mysql initfile ...

    如何优化MySQL数据库性能,让你的网站飞一般的快 |c mysql linux
  • 如何优化mysql数据库性能,提升网站速度? |mysql迁移库
  • 如何优化mysql数据库性能,提升网站速度? |mysql迁移库 | 如何优化mysql数据库性能,提升网站速度? |mysql迁移库 ...